以文本方式查看主题 - Foxtable(狐表) (http://foxtable.com/bbs/index.asp) -- 专家坐堂 (http://foxtable.com/bbs/list.asp?boardid=2) ---- 如何按顺序组合成一个整体? (http://foxtable.com/bbs/dispbbs.asp?boardid=2&id=40121) |
-- 作者:fubblyc -- 发布时间:2013/9/10 8:49:00 -- 如何按顺序组合成一个整体? 各位大侠早上好,如何通过代码实现下图效果? |
-- 作者:Bin -- 发布时间:2013/9/10 8:56:00 -- 使用表达式列,输入表达式 [近度级别]+[密度级别]+[强度级别]+[宽度级别] 即可 前提你要是字符串列,如果是数值.那么需要转换一下. Convert([近度级别],\'System.String\')+Convert([密度级别],\'System.String\')+Convert([强度级别],\'System.String\')+Convert([宽度级别],\'System.String\')
|
-- 作者:fubblyc -- 发布时间:2013/9/10 8:57:00 -- 可以用代码吗?表达式我想尽量少用 |
-- 作者:Bin -- 发布时间:2013/9/10 8:58:00 -- 代码也是同样的原理哦 datacolchanged 事件 e.datarow("类别")=e.datarow("列1")+e.datarow("列2")
|
-- 作者:fubblyc -- 发布时间:2013/9/10 15:05:00 -- 看了帮助半天,不知道怎么通过代码把数据转换成字符。不过用了个土办法,直接把列的属性改为了字符型,也能实现了。
请教Bin老师,整数转换成字符的代码怎么写呢?
|
-- 作者:Bin -- 发布时间:2013/9/10 15:12:00 -- e.datarow("类别")=e.datarow("列1") & e.datarow("列2") 直接当作字符串使用即可. |
-- 作者:fubblyc -- 发布时间:2013/9/10 22:41:00 -- 谢谢Bin老师,已理解并完成!! |